jmeter report分析

Jmeter在执行命令后生成测试文档 。jtl如何生成html测试报告cmd并进入bin目录执行jmetereo背景注意:JMeter有两种执行方式,一种是GUI模式,一种是非GUI模式,GUI模式是界面模式,非GUI模式是命令行模式,GUI模式主要用于编写和调试脚本,命令行模式是测试接口性能的最佳方式,因为这种模式可以与其他框架对接,可以与自动化测试平台集成,非GUI模式适用于以下场景:1 .它节省了更多的资源 , 更容易集成多个工具集;2.当被访问的接口服务需要通过代理服务器完成时;3.当一台机器产生的压力不够时 , 采用分布式多机远程执行方式,使一个主控制器可以控制多台压机,同时产生更多的压力请求,使客户端可以模拟大并发请求;4.命令行可以通过外部参数将数据传入脚本 , 以便外部系统在调用jmeter时更好地集成和传递参数 。例如 , 当jenkins启动并执行接口自动化时 , 参数从jenkins的接口传递到jmeter,该接口由命令行参数桥接 。

1、Jmeter用命令执行后生成测试文档.jtl怎么生成html测试报告cmd进入bin目录,执行jmetereo 。尝试堆栈跟踪 。你不熟悉这个软件 。jmeter的错误一般是脚本中的错误 。如果接口明确知道返回中的错误信息,可以根据返回的错误代码和信息定位错误 。我们应该看的是应用程序或界面的详细日志 。更常见的方式是跟踪数据 , 找到报错的记录,找到手机号、订单号、用户id等关键数据 。,然后利用这些数据进行手工或者单项测试,根据debug或者linxu的log log日志或者相关的堆栈日志来确定异常问题 。

2、如何使用Jmeter进行压力测试2 。两个节点,测试计划和工作台,将出现在左边的树中 。3.选择测试计划,右键【添加-】threads(users)线程组,设置可以并发使用多少个线程进行压力测试 。不要在“循环次数”设置中选择永远,将循环次数设置为1 。4.现在先介绍如何设置登录http请求,选择线程组,右键-添加-采样器-HTTP请求 。Http请求模拟浏览器访问 。

登录需要输入用户名和密码 。将参数添加到“随请求发送参数”列表 。根据web应用程序设置参数值 。比如login _ user0001login _ password1ActFlaglogin5 。登录成功后 , 网站一般会跳转到主页面 。在jmap中,登录后可以判断是否按预期进入主页面(不需要这一步) 。在4中选择“http Request”,右键单击Add Assertion响应断言 。

3、如何用Jmeter做压力测试服务器提供的一个接口的例子是:经过评估,可以使用jmeter进行压力测试 。步骤是:开始jmeter:点击jmeter 。垃圾桶下面的球棒 。运行jmeter2 。创建一个测试计划:默认情况下,当您启动jmeter时,将会加载一个测试技术模板 。3.保存测试计划:将名称改为http_demo,点击Save , 并选择保存路径 。4.在线程组右边的树中添加测试计划的“http_demo”节点,然后“Add”>“http_demo”节点下有一个线程组节点 。5.添加一个http默认请求:(用于配置公共参数,不是HTTP请求)右键单击线程组,选择添加>配置组件> HTTP请求默认,点击HTTP请求默认添加成功 。在线程组节点6下添加了HTTP请求的默认值 。设置HTTP请求的默认值:为这个项目填写以下内容 , 为服务器填写默认请求名称、服务器和默认请求路径,保存测试计划7 。添加HTTP request http_demo的右键,选择Add \\" Sampler \\" HTTP request 。添加成功后,将获得HTTP请求的默认值 。
4、如何在 jmeter的测试报告中显示失败的responseData【jmeter report分析】FailureDetail模块显示responsedata: 1 。在测试报告模板(jmeterresults detailreport_ 1.0 . xsl)中:a .将showData设置为 y b并替换内容responsefailuremessageresponsedata 。

    推荐阅读